To facilitate a new rail link between Helsinki and Turku, five separate railway plans will be prepared and developed further toward the construction stage as individual plans. A dedicated planning consultant is in charge of each railway plan.
The railway planning by the project company is based on previous planning and assessments by the Finnish Transport Infrastructure Agency. The materials can be reviewed on the Finnish Transport Infrastructure Agency’s project website.
West Railway comprises the following railway plans:
- Espoo–Lohja (Espoo–Salo direct railway line)
- Lohja–Salo (Espoo–Salo direct railway line)
- Salo–Hajala (Salo–Turku double-track railway line)
- Hajala–Nunna (Salo–Turku double-track railway line)
- Nunna–Kupittaa (Salo–Turku double-track railway line)

Railway plans
Espoo-Salo direct railway line
Plans will be prepared for a completely new railway line between Espoo and Salo. The direct line is divided into two railway plans (Espoo–Lohja and Lohja–Salo) and four separate subtasks: Espoo–Vihti, Vihti–Lohja, Lohja–Suomusjärvi and Suomusjärvi–Salo.
The result of the planning process will be a double-track mixed traffic railway line, where the speed of passenger trains will be 200 km/h. The track geometry will be designed to also allow for train speeds of up to 300 km/h.
Stations: Hista, Veikkola, Vihti-Nummela, Lohjansolmu.
Station reservations: Myntinmäki in Espoo, Huhmari in Vihti, Lahnajärvi in Salo, Suomusjärvi in Salo, and Muurla in Salo.
Municipalities within the planning area: Espoo, Kirkkonummi, Vihti, Lohja, Salo
Length of the railway section: approximately 98 km
Salo-Hajala
Plans will be prepared for a second track next to the existing track between Salo and Hajala. The planning comprises, among other things, 14 new bridges, 3 bridges that require widening or repairs, 2 new tunnels, and a review of the placement of the new track in relation to the existing one.
Municipalities within the planning area: Salo
Length of the railway section: approximately 10 km
Hajala-Nunna
Plans will be prepared for a second track next to the existing track between Hajala and Nunna comprising the cutoffs at Hajala, Kriivari and Piikkiö. The section’s planning will comprise 40 new bridges, and the area also includes 11 bridges that require repairs.
Length of the railway section: approximately 33.5 km
Municipalities within the planning area: Salo, Paimio, Kaarina, Turku
Nunna-Kupittaa
Plans will be prepared for a second track next to the existing track between Nunna and Kupittaa. The planning will comprise eight new bridges as well as repair planning for seven bridges. The area also includes bridges that will be demolished.
Municipalities within the planning area: Kaarina, Turku
Length of the railway section: approximately 8 km
